How does work?
Depending upon what you’re looking for, offers therapy for couples, individuals, or families. You create an account and fill out a survey to discover the right match.
Throughout the survey, you have the ability to list out your therapist choices, including their gender, religion, age, sexual orientation, language, in addition to what issues you’re hoping to tackle, and how important it is that your counselor be well versed in those subjects.
It can take anywhere from a few hours to a number of days to be matched to an in-state therapist.
According to, counselors are accredited, trained, experienced, and accredited psychologists, marital relationship and family therapists, medical social workers, or certified expert therapists.
All the business’s counselors have a master’s or doctorate degree and possess a minimum of 3 years and 2,000 hours of experience as mental health experts.
You can just email to be reassigned if you do not like who you’re combined with.

Once you have actually been matched with a therapist, you can right away start messaging them in a secure and personal chat room.
The chat room is accessible at any time as long as your gadget has dependable web. Messaging isn’t carried out in real-time, so there’s no guaranteed action time from your therapist. As a result, you’re complimentary to message your therapist at any hour of the day.
Your counselor will reply with questions, research, guidance, or feedback, and the app will alert you of their reaction.
The discussions are conserved in the chatroom so you’re totally free to show and reread whenever you ‘d like. Every conversation is likewise protected by strict federal and state HIPAA laws.

Not everyone is totally convinced that shifting mental health care online is the method forward. “You get to know not only what it’s like to talk to the individual, but how it feels to be in a room with them.
” I have actually performed some research into Skype counselling,” states London-based psychotherapist Dr Aaron Balick, “and it’s not the ‘practical equivalent’ of conventional counselling; it’s simply not quite the same thing. It’s actually essential that people who participate in it are aware that it’s a various experience from remaining in the room with somebody, speaking in person.”

” In terms of ease of access, it’s a great start and definitely better than nothing. It’ll ideally lead them to ultimately showing up in the space. However, if you’re dealing with relationship issues, accessory problems, or deeper concerns, it’s much better to be in the room with somebody. Skype and the web offers a distance from your counsellor that may not be valuable.”
In cases of mild depression, the NHS is now directing some clients towards online programs rather than in person counselling, a phenomenon that worries Dr Balick.
” My fear is that it’s occurring more and more for financial factors, rather than due to the fact that it’s what’s finest for individuals. That’s not great if it’s rolled out just to save money and there aren’t important concerns being asked about these services. However then, I’m constantly very sceptical of individuals who are either very extremely pro or really extremely against online mental healthcare. It’s a case of asking the ideal concerns.”
